Ordinals
beta
Sat 290157046373498
decimal
58031.2046373498
degree
0°58031′1583″2046373498‴
percentile
13.817002223460516%
name
luhriupccqx
cycle
0
epoch
0
period
28
block
58031
offset
2046373498
timestamp
2010-05-27 13:48:44 UTC
rarity
common
prev
next